Major Update – Daniel Rodimer Turns Himself In On Murder Charge, What Happened?

WWE Tough Enough alumnus Daniel Rodimer has turned himself in after a warrant was issued for his arrest over a murder charge in Las Vegas, NV.

KLAS is reporting that Rodimer turned himself in at the Clark County Detention Center around 6:00 PM local time on Wednesday.

The report states that detectives believe Rodimer attacked Christopher Tapp, on October 29th after Tapp allegedly offered Rodimer’s stepdaughter cocaine during a party at a Las Vegas hotel room. While Tapp’s death was initially believed to be an “apparent overdose” and “fall,” his autopsy showed blunt force trauma to the head. He also had cocaine in his system. Tapp later died at Sunrise Hospital in Las Vegas, NV on November 5th.

It was noted that the detectives in charge of the case learned during their investigation that Rodimer and Tapp were involved in a physical altercation, which occurred after the alleged cocaine offer to Rodimer’s stepdaughter. One witness said Rodimer told Tapp, “If you ever talk to my daughter again, I’ll [expletive] kill you.” Immediately after, the witness heard “two loud banging noises.”

Another witness said they saw Rodimer knock Tapp to the ground and that Tapp’s head hit a small table. At that point, Rodimer punched Tapp “throughout his head and body.” A third witness came forward to say Tapp slipped and fell, hitting his head on a coffee table. Several other witnesses told police that many people at the party used cocaine on the night of the incident.

There are also texts between Rodimer and his wife Sarah, who texted, “I watched you nearly murder somebody and I had to take your [expletive] hands off from his neck as he laid there and you ran away and I spent the next two hours trying to take care of him. Nobody should have to watch their husband murder somebody…. I watched you murder somebody like let that sink in your psychopath.”

Tapp and Rodimer reportedly knew each other through the classic car and racing circuit.

It’s worth noting that Tapp previously served two decades in prison for a crime he did not commit. Tapp was convicted in the 1996 rape and murder of an 18-year-old girl despite being exonerated by DNA evidence. At the time, Tapp was sentenced to life in prison with a minimum 30 year sentence. The conviction was vacated in July of 2019.

Rodimer resurfaced in 2021 as a Republican candidate from Nevada who was endorsed by Donald Trump. He ran for an open congressional seat in Texas against 22 other candidates. Rodimer, who is from New Jersey, tried to portray himself as a Texan and was mocked for “cosplaying.” He also ran for office in Nevada in 2020. He lost big in both of his election races.

UPDATE: Rodimer has been released from jail after posting a $200,000 bond at 7:43 PM PST. He is due for a court hearing on April 10th at 7:30 AM.
